bcopy - copy byte sequence

Standard C library (libc, -lc)

#include <strings.h>
[[deprecated]] void bcopy(const void src[.n], void dest[.n], size_t n);

The bcopy() function copies n bytes from src to dest. The result is correct, even when both areas overlap.

4.3BSD. This function is deprecated (marked as LEGACY in POSIX.1-2001): use memcpy(3) or memmove(3) in new programs. Note that the first two arguments are interchanged for memcpy(3) and memmove(3). POSIX.1-2008 removes the specification of bcopy().
